如果表中没有记录数据更新的时间,那么无法直接判断表中数据24小时内是否有变化。但是,可以通过其他方式来实现类似的功能。以下是一些可能的方法:

  1. 使用定时任务或者触发器在每24小时的指定时间点触发查询操作,统计表中数据总量,记录到另一个表中。下次查询时,比较当前数据总量和上次记录的数据总量是否一致即可判断24小时内是否有数据变化。

  2. 在表中添加一个时间戳字段,每次插入、更新、删除操作时更新该字段的值。查询时比较当前时间和最近更新时间的差值是否小于24小时即可判断24小时内是否有数据变化。

  3. 如果表中有一个自增主键或者是创建时间字段,可以根据这个字段来判断24小时内是否有数据变化。例如,记录当前表中最大的自增主键或者最新的创建时间,下次查询时比较当前表中最大的自增主键或者最新的创建时间和上次记录的值是否相等,如果相等则表示24小时内没有数据变化。

需要注意的是,以上方法都有一定的局限性和不确定性,因为它们都基于一些假设条件。如果数据表结构或者数据操作方式发生变化,可能会导致判断结果不准确。


原文地址: https://www.cveoy.top/t/topic/m1pf 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录